I bought this off another member on here a while ago and have now got another spoiler so don't need this anymore.
Its a replica Prodrive boot spoiler with brake light, it fixes onto the boot using the same holes as a low level spoiler and fits without any mods to the holes.
It comes with the fixing bolts and led brake light.
There is some damage from the previous owner who used a bolt which was the wrong length and pushed up throught the top skin but this would be easy to repair. Open offers not after much.
